What is wealth maximization?

Wealth maximization is the concept of increasing the value of a business in order to increase the value of the shares held by its stockholders. The most direct evidence of wealth maximization is changes in the price of a company’s shares.

What is the rationale for wealth maximization as a goal for a firm?

When business managers try to maximize the wealth of their firm, they are actually trying to increase the company’s stock price. As the stock price increases, the value of the firm increases, as well as the shareholders’ wealth.

How is wealth maximization objective better than profit maximization objective explain?

Profit maximization is an inappropriate goal because it’s short term in nature and focus more on what earnings are generated rather than value maximization which comply to shareholders wealth maximization. Wealth maximization overcomes all the limitations that profit maximization possesses.

How do you calculate increase in wealth maximization?

Increase in Wealth = Present Value of cash inflows – Cost. Wealth maximization model is a superior model because it obviates all the drawbacks of profit maximization as a goal of a financial decision. Firstly, the wealth maximization is based on cash flows and not on profits.

When does the wealth of a shareholder maximizes?

A wealth of a shareholder maximizes when the net worth of a company maximizes. To be even more meticulous, a shareholder holds share in the company/business and his wealth will improve if the share price in the market increases which in turn is a function of net worth.
